Score 90/100 · Drink 2016-2021, Antonio Galloni, Vinous, Jul 2016
Rodney Strong's 2013 Cabernet Sauvignon Estate Vineyards (Alexander Valley) is plump, juicy and attractive, all qualities that make it an excellent choice for drinking now and over the next handful of years. Expressive savory and mineral notes are laced into a core of dark red plum fruit with more than enough depth to balance the tannins. There is a lot to like here.

Score 88/100 · Drink 2016-2031, Robert Parker, Mar 2016
The 2013 Estate Cabernet Sauvignon has an opaque ruby/purple color, a nice, sweet kiss of black currants and cherries, some dusty loamy soil notes and a hint of graphite. The tannins are moderate, and the wine medium to full-bodied and made for a good 15 or more years of longevity. However, it is accessible now.
